Rich, cheesy, and ultra-comforting, this Million Dollar Ravioli Casserole lives up to its name with layers of creamy cheese, hearty meat sauce, and pillowy ravioli baked to bubbly perfection. It’s the ultimate no-fuss dinner that feels indulgent but is incredibly easy to throw together—perfect for busy weeknights, freezer meals, or when you want to impress a crowd without breaking a sweat.
Want recipes like this delivered straight to your inbox? Subscribe now to get the latest culinary creations you’ll love.
Why You’ll Love This Recipe
Restaurant-Worthy Comfort – All the flavor of a baked lasagna, without the effort.
No Boiling Required – Use frozen or fresh ravioli straight from the bag.
Family Favorite – Even picky eaters go back for seconds.
Make-Ahead Friendly – Assemble ahead and bake when needed.
Freezer Perfect – Bake one now, freeze one for later.
Ingredients You’ll Need
- 1 (25 oz) bag frozen cheese ravioli (no need to thaw)
- 1 lb ground beef or chicken
- 1 (24 oz) jar marinara or pasta sauce
- 1 tsp Italian seasoning
- ½ tsp garlic powder
- Salt and pepper to taste
For the Creamy Cheese Layer:
- 8 oz cream cheese, softened
- 1 cup ricotta cheese
- 1 cup sour cream
- 1½ cups shredded mozzarella cheese
- ½ cup grated Parmesan cheese
Topping:
- 1 cup shredded mozzarella cheese
- Chopped parsley or basil for garnish (optional)
Tools You’ll Need
- Large skillet
- Mixing bowl
- 9×13-inch casserole dish
- Spatula
- Aluminum foil
Step-by-Step Instructions
Step 1: Preheat the Oven
Preheat your oven to 375°F (190°C).
Lightly grease a 9×13-inch baking dish with cooking spray or butter.
Step 2: Cook the Meat Sauce
In a large skillet, brown the ground beef or chicken over medium heat until fully cooked.
Drain excess grease, then stir in marinara sauce, Italian seasoning, garlic powder, salt, and pepper.
Simmer for 5 minutes to blend the flavors. Remove from heat.
Step 3: Mix the Creamy Cheese Filling
In a medium mixing bowl, combine softened cream cheese, ricotta, sour cream, mozzarella, and Parmesan cheese.
Mix until smooth and creamy. This is your “million dollar” cheese layer!
Step 4: Layer the Casserole
Spread 1 cup of the meat sauce in the bottom of the prepared baking dish.
Layer half the frozen ravioli over the sauce.
Spread all of the creamy cheese mixture over the ravioli.
Top with half of the remaining meat sauce.
Add the rest of the ravioli and finish with the remaining meat sauce.
Sprinkle 1 cup of shredded mozzarella cheese evenly over the top.
Step 5: Bake
Cover loosely with foil and bake for 30 minutes.
Remove foil and bake for an additional 10–15 minutes, or until the cheese is melted and bubbly.
Let sit for 10 minutes before serving.
Tips for Best Results
Use Frozen Ravioli – No need to thaw; it bakes perfectly in the oven.
Swap the Protein – Try ground turkey or plant-based crumbles for variation.
Make It Spicy – Add a pinch of red pepper flakes to the meat sauce.
Boost the Flavor – Stir in a spoonful of pesto to the cheese mixture for an herbaceous twist.
Don’t Overbake – Bake just until golden and bubbly for the creamiest texture.
Serving Suggestions
Garlic Bread – Ideal for soaking up extra sauce.
Simple Green Salad – A fresh, crisp contrast to the rich casserole.
Roasted Broccoli – Adds a healthy, flavorful side.
Bruschetta – A light, tangy appetizer to start things off.
Iced Tea or Lemonade – Complements the cozy flavors with refreshing contrast.
How to Store & Reheat
Storing:
Refrigerate: Keep leftovers in an airtight container for up to 4 days.
Freeze: Assemble the unbaked casserole, wrap tightly in foil, and freeze for up to 2 months. Thaw overnight in the fridge before baking.
Reheating:
Oven: Cover with foil and reheat at 350°F for 20–25 minutes.
Microwave: Heat individual portions on medium power for 1–2 minutes.
Frequently Asked Questions
- Can I use meat ravioli instead of cheese?
Yes, meat ravioli works just as well and makes the dish even heartier. - Do I have to use ricotta?
No, you can swap with cottage cheese or add more cream cheese or sour cream instead. - Can I use fresh ravioli?
Absolutely! Fresh ravioli may cook slightly faster, so reduce bake time by 5–7 minutes. - Is it okay to make this dairy-free?
Yes, use dairy-free cheeses and sour cream substitutes for a similar result. - How do I make this vegetarian?
Skip the meat and use sautéed mushrooms or spinach instead.
Final Thoughts
Million Dollar Ravioli Casserole is the definition of easy comfort food. With layers of creamy cheese, savory meat sauce, and tender pasta, it’s the kind of meal that brings everyone to the table with smiles. Whether you’re meal prepping, feeding a crowd, or just treating yourself, this recipe is a winner every time.
Make it once and it’ll earn a permanent spot in your meal rotation. Don’t forget to tag your dish online—we’d love to see your take on this creamy, cozy casserole!
Preparation Time: 15 minutes
Cooking Time: 45 minutes
Cuisine: American–Italian
Nutritional Information (Per Serving):
Calories: 540 | Protein: 29g | Carbohydrates: 36g | Fat: 32g | Fiber: 2g | Sodium: 780mg

Million Dollar Ravioli Casserole
- Total Time: 1 hour
Description
Rich, cheesy, and ultra-comforting, this Million Dollar Ravioli Casserole lives up to its name with layers of creamy cheese, hearty meat sauce, and pillowy ravioli baked to bubbly perfection. It’s the ultimate no-fuss dinner that feels indulgent but is incredibly easy to throw together—perfect for busy weeknights, freezer meals, or when you want to impress a crowd without breaking a sweat.
Want recipes like this delivered straight to your inbox? Subscribe now to get the latest culinary creations you’ll love.
Ingredients
Ingredients You’ll Need
-
1 (25 oz) bag frozen cheese ravioli (no need to thaw)
-
1 lb ground beef or chicken
-
1 (24 oz) jar marinara or pasta sauce
-
1 tsp Italian seasoning
-
½ tsp garlic powder
-
Salt and pepper to taste
For the Creamy Cheese Layer:
-
8 oz cream cheese, softened
-
1 cup ricotta cheese
-
1 cup sour cream
-
1½ cups shredded mozzarella cheese
-
½ cup grated Parmesan cheese
Topping:
-
1 cup shredded mozzarella cheese
-
Chopped parsley or basil for garnish (optional)
Instructions
Step 1: Preheat the Oven
Preheat your oven to 375°F (190°C).
Lightly grease a 9×13-inch baking dish with cooking spray or butter.
Step 2: Cook the Meat Sauce
In a large skillet, brown the ground beef or chicken over medium heat until fully cooked.
Drain excess grease, then stir in marinara sauce, Italian seasoning, garlic powder, salt, and pepper.
Simmer for 5 minutes to blend the flavors. Remove from heat.
Step 3: Mix the Creamy Cheese Filling
In a medium mixing bowl, combine softened cream cheese, ricotta, sour cream, mozzarella, and Parmesan cheese.
Mix until smooth and creamy. This is your “million dollar” cheese layer!
Step 4: Layer the Casserole
Spread 1 cup of the meat sauce in the bottom of the prepared baking dish.
Layer half the frozen ravioli over the sauce.
Spread all of the creamy cheese mixture over the ravioli.
Top with half of the remaining meat sauce.
Add the rest of the ravioli and finish with the remaining meat sauce.
Sprinkle 1 cup of shredded mozzarella cheese evenly over the top.
Step 5: Bake
Cover loosely with foil and bake for 30 minutes.
Remove foil and bake for an additional 10–15 minutes, or until the cheese is melted and bubbly.
Let sit for 10 minutes before serving.
Notes
Use Frozen Ravioli – No need to thaw; it bakes perfectly in the oven.
Swap the Protein – Try ground turkey or plant-based crumbles for variation.
Make It Spicy – Add a pinch of red pepper flakes to the meat sauce.
Boost the Flavor – Stir in a spoonful of pesto to the cheese mixture for an herbaceous twist.
Don’t Overbake – Bake just until golden and bubbly for the creamiest texture.
- Prep Time: 15 minutes
- Cook Time: 45 minutes
- Cuisine: American–Italian